Question:
How is the animal kingdom classified?
Answer:
Scientists classify animals based on their body structure, level of organization, body symmetry, and presence of a backbone. The classification helps in studying and understanding relationships between species.
Key Points
- Two broad groups: Vertebrates (with backbone), Invertebrates (without backbone).
- Further divided into phyla like Arthropoda, Mollusca, Annelida, Chordata, etc.
- Basis of classification: Symmetry, coelom, body layers, segmentation.
